Our experience is to work in two directions. The first is to improve our user usage path and then identify the specific point in the process that leads to user churn. The second seems like a "clumsy" method, but it's very effective. We frequently reach out to churned users to ask questions, and over time, we identify the root causes and can form a sample

From my experience, the biggest frustration with trial conversions is the lack of real-time insight into user behavior and motivations—often, users drop off silently without leaving any clues. Currently, we try to gather feedback through in-app surveys and follow-up emails, but response rates are usually low and tend to come too late. Some teams also use product analytics tools to track feature usage, which helps identify where users get stuck or lose interest, but it doesn’t always explain the “why” behind their decisions. If free trials are not converting, this implies your users see no value beyond the trial duration. Either these users are getting all they need from a very short period of usage or it simply is not good enough to justify its price.
